static int luksDump_with_volume_key(struct crypt_device *cd)
{
char *vk = NULL, *password = NULL;
unsigned int passwordLen = 0;
size_t vk_size;
int i, r;
crypt_set_confirm_callback(cd, _yesDialog, NULL);
if (!_yesDialog(
_("LUKS header dump with volume key is sensitive information\n"
"which allows access to encrypted partition without passphrase.\n"
"This dump should be always stored encrypted on safe place."),
NULL))
return -EPERM;
vk_size = crypt_get_volume_key_size(cd);
vk = crypt_safe_alloc(vk_size);
if (!vk)
return -ENOMEM;
r = crypt_get_key(_("Enter LUKS passphrase: "), &password, &passwordLen,
opt_keyfile_size, opt_key_file, opt_timeout, 0, cd);
if (r < 0)
goto out;
r = crypt_volume_key_get(cd, CRYPT_ANY_SLOT, vk, &vk_size,
password, passwordLen);
if (r < 0)
goto out;
log_std("LUKS header information for %s\n", crypt_get_device_name(cd));
log_std("Cipher name: \t%s\n", crypt_get_cipher(cd));
log_std("Cipher mode: \t%s\n", crypt_get_cipher_mode(cd));
log_std("Payload offset:\t%d\n", crypt_get_data_offset(cd));
log_std("UUID: \t%s\n", crypt_get_uuid(cd));
log_std("MK bits: \t%d\n", vk_size * 8);
log_std("MK dump:\t");
for(i = 0; i < vk_size; i++) {
if (i && !(i % 16))
log_std("\n\t\t");
log_std("%02hhx ", (char)vk[i]);
}
log_std("\n");
out:
crypt_safe_free(password);
crypt_safe_free(vk);
return r;
}
